Ideas for unusual dates

Are you tired of the same old movie and dinner routine? If so you may be looking for some fun and unusual dating ideas. There is not a limit to what can constitute a fun date (it usually only depends on your dating budget and who you are with). So the next time you want to impress that someone special here are some ideas for unusual dates-

- Sky Diving-For a real thrill you can take your date sky diving. Keep in mind that this can be costly (typically $100 or more per person), but it is usually an once-in-a-lifetime experience for most folks. You can check your local yellow pages for sky-diving schools or for a little tamer twist check out some of the skydiving venues that are now offered inside. After being properly suited up you are taken into a wind chamber that allows you to simulate sky diving. You and you date can still get that thrill of flying for nearly half the price.
- Take a cooking class-This is great way to get know someone. Food is a universal experience and gives you lots to talk about. There are plenty of one night only classes available or if you are seriously interested in someone you may want to sign up for a regular class. Bon Appetit!
- Test drive cars- Just be sure that you visit the best car dealers in your area and test drive their most luxurious and expensive vehicles. Make sure to let your date drive half the time. This is a budget friendly date that can give you a glimpse into how the other half lives.
- Attend an art or film festival-Many cities have periodic art or film festivals that feature new artists in the entertainment world. Best of all you can get tickets to attractions for a fraction of the cost after they have been released. While many of these art displays and films can be rather avant garde you and your date will be seeing what is right around the corner in the art and film world.
- Go to a farmer's market-Get ingredients to cooks dinner from your local farmers market. Most cities have a Farmer's Market of some size that offers the freshest in produce and other products. Make a game of it that you will only use what you can find at the Farmer's Market to make lunch or dinner. You will be saving money, having fun and being kind to the planet all at the same time!
- Go on a treasure hunt-You can rent or borrow a metal detector and search abandoned parks, beaches and vacant lot for "treasures" like coins and jewelry. You may be shocked at the treasures you will find!
- Attend dance school-Most dance schools will offer an introductory class for free. You can usually learn basic waltz steps in just one class and you can carry the knowledge on from wedding to wedding.
- Gather from the wild! If you live in a relatively rural area you can spend an afternoon gathering wild strawberries, blackberries or raspberries. Many areas even offer a "You pick then pay" option. After picking your delights you can then make shortcake for dessert!
- Have a drink! If you live in a wine growing area be sure to check out the wineries for wine tasting events and festivals. Many of these festivals include live music, too!
- Attend an auction! Bidding at an auction can be a lot of fun and browsing through antique items and home décor is a great way to get to know each others' tastes.
- Volunteer at a local animal shelter-Most animal shelters are always looking for volunteers for walking dogs and petting cats. You and your date can have a lot of fun by spending a few hours giving some homeless animals a little loving attention.
